LT Debt to Total Assets is a measurement representing the percentage of a corporation's assets that are financed with loans and financial obligations lasting more than one year. The ratio provides a general measure of the financial position of a company, including its ability to meet financial requirements for outstanding loans. It is calculated as a company's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ligationdivide by its Total Assets. LT Debt to Total Asset is a measurement representing the percentage of a corporation's assets that are financed with loans and financial obligations lasting more than one year. The ratio provides a general measure of the financial position of a company, including its ability to meet financial requirements for outstanding loans. A year-over-year decrease in this metric would suggest the company is progressively becoming less dependent on debt to grow their business.

ADF Foods Business Description

Other Exchanges ADFFOODS:India
Address G. K. Road, Marathon Innova, B2 - G01, Ground Floor, Opp. Peninsula Corporate Park, Lower Parel, Mumbai, MH, IND, 400013
ADF Foods Ltd is an Indian-based company that operates in the business of processed and preserved foods. Its business activities include manufacturing and trading of processed food products including pickles, pastes, chutneys, ready-to-eat items, paste and sauces, frozen foods, spices, and canned vegetables in brine. The company's operating segments are Processed food and Distribution Business. The company's products are offered under the brand names Ashoka, Camel, Truly Indian, Aeroplane, Nate's, PJ's Organics, ADF Soul, and Khansaama.
